Hi Ricardo, I imagine that Mike has not had a chance to get to this, so I took a stab at fixing this problem. Could you test out the attached patch? Copy the file to $PROJECT_HOME then: cd $PROJECT_HOME patch -p0 <PostgresWriter.diff Then rebuild the GUS/DBAdmin project and redump the schema from the XML schema file: build GUS/DBAdmin install -append dbaDumpSchema -sourceType xml -source GusSchema/Definition/config/gus_schema.xml -targetType postgres -target gus.pg.ddl That should produce the proper PostgreSQL ddl from which you can grep the version views and test the loads.
